在加密货币交易中,MetaMask作为一个广受欢迎的数字钱包,允许用户方便地管理以太坊及其ERC-20代币。然而,用户们常常会遇到转账未到账的烦恼,这不仅影响了交易体验,有时还可能造成资金损失。本文将从多个角度深入分析这个问题,提供解决方案,并回答一些相关问题。
在理解转账未到账的原因之前,有必要了解MetaMask转账的基本工作原理。MetaMask是一种非托管钱包,意味着用户对其资金有完全控制权。每次转账都需要通过区块链网络进行验证,这个过程涉及到多个节点的参与。
当用户在MetaMask中发起转账时,实际上是在向区块链网络广播一个交易请求。此请求中包含发起方的地址、接收方的地址、转账金额及交易手续费等信息。交易一旦被矿工确认并写入区块链,就会在网络中显示为“已完成”。
转账未到账可能由多种因素导致,以下是一些常见原因:
在MetaMask中,如果发现转账长时间未到账,首要步骤便是确认转账的状态。以下是一些确认方法:
为了提高MetaMask交易的成功率,用户可以采用以下策略:
如果交易已经被确认但仍未到账,可以尝试以下解决方法:
设置MetaMask的交易手续费,是确保交易迅速和顺利完成的重要步骤。在以太坊网络中,交易手续费即“Gas费”,是矿工处理交易的报酬。若交易需要尽快确认,建议设置比正常水平稍高的Gas。同时,用户可以使用Gas Station等工具来查看当前网络的推荐Gas费,根据实时网络情况进行设置。
交易哈希是每笔交易在区块链上唯一的标识符,可以用于在区块链浏览器(如Etherscan)中查询交易的状态。通常在转账确认后,MetaMask会显示该交易的哈希值,用户也可以在交易记录中找到。在浏览器中输入该哈希值,就可以查看该笔交易的详细信息,包括确认次数、发送和接收地址、转账金额等。
交易在链上的确认速度受多种因素影响,主要包括网络拥堵程度和所设定的交易手续费。如果在网络高峰时段(如某种代币上线或大规模活动时),节点可能会处理大量的交易请求,而用户设置的Gas费不足以吸引矿工优先处理,因此交易将处于待确认状态。在这种情况下,用户可选择提高Gas费或耐心等待。
为了防止输入错误地址,用户可以在MetaMask中使用“地址簿”功能,将常用地址保存起来,直接选择保存的地址进行转账。此外,在发送前请务必仔细查看所输入的地址,确保没有多余的字符或笔误。同时,在确认转账完成后,及时通知接收方验证是否到账,以进一步确保交易的安全性。
如果交易长时间未得到确认,可以尝试重新发送交易。此时要确保对Gas费的设置足够高,以提高交易被确认的概率。在MetaMask中,也可通过“增补交易”功能修改未确认交易的Gas费,达到加快确认的目的。然而,用户必须先了解当前未确认交易的状态,以免重复发送造成混乱。
在MetaMask中进行代币交易时,用户应特别注意以下几个方面:首先,确保代币合约的真实性,避免与假冒合约进行交易。第二,某些代币可能会有特定的限制或特殊的转账流程(如需要先批准),用户需提前了解。最后,注意合约的转账手续费,有些代币可能会收取额外费用。因此,提前研究所交易的代币,可以避免后续可能出现的问题。
总结来说,MetaMask是一个功能强大且灵活的数字货币钱包,但用户在使用过程中的操作失误或网络问题都可能导致转账未到账。了解基本原理,确认交易状态,以及及时处理问题是确保交易顺利进行的关键。希望通过本文的分析,能帮助用户更好地管理自身资金,顺畅地进行加密货币交易。